Q: What is the typical minimum order quantity (MOQ) for sesame seeds?
A: The typical MOQ for sesame seeds can vary, but for bulk orders such as a twenty-foot container, suppliers usually require orders of at least 10 metric tons.
Q: What shipping considerations should I keep in mind when exporting sesame seeds to the UAE?
A: Ensure compliance with UAE import regulations, including quality certifications and proper packaging. Additionally, consider using reliable shipping methods that provide tracking and timely delivery.
Q: Are there specific quality standards for sesame seeds in the UAE?
A: Yes, sesame seeds must meet specific quality standards, including low moisture content (usually below 7%) and absence of mold or foreign materials. Certification from recognized bodies can enhance buyer confidence.
Q: What payment terms are commonly accepted for B2B transactions in this sector?
A: Payment terms can vary, but common practices include letters of credit, advance payments, or net terms based on mutual agreement. It's advisable to discuss and finalize terms before shipment.
